- 16 Feb, 1993 1 commit
-
-
From-SVN: r3474
Michael Meissner committed
-
- 15 Feb, 1993 1 commit
-
-
From-SVN: r3473
Richard Stallman committed
-
- 13 Feb, 1993 5 commits
-
-
From-SVN: r3472
Richard Stallman committed -
From-SVN: r3471
Richard Stallman committed -
From-SVN: r3470
Richard Stallman committed -
From-SVN: r3469
Richard Stallman committed -
From-SVN: r3468
Doug Evans committed
-
- 12 Feb, 1993 4 commits
-
-
From-SVN: r3467
Per Bothner committed -
From-SVN: r3466
Torbjorn Granlund committed -
for zero length prologue and epilogue list. From-SVN: r3465
John Hassey committed -
Swallow any preprocessing number as a (possibly erroneous) number. From-SVN: r3464
Richard Stallman committed
-
- 11 Feb, 1993 4 commits
-
-
(main): Pass short name of program as first arg to fork_execute; ensure argv[0] always gets filename. (fork_execute): Print name for diagnostic from PROG; filename comes from argv[0]. From-SVN: r3463
Richard Kenner committed -
`x'; some use `c' or `g'. From-SVN: r3462
Richard Kenner committed -
(last_file_name): New variable. (find_a_file): Ignore name in last_file_name too. (main): Look at name in COLLECT_NAME and set it to the name we were called with. Pass filename used for ld to ld as argv[0]. From-SVN: r3461
Richard Kenner committed -
out of arglist of emit_block_move. From-SVN: r3460
Richard Stallman committed
-
- 10 Feb, 1993 6 commits
-
-
(current_file_function_operand): New function, replaces current_function_operand. (print_operand, case 'F'): Case deleted. (alpha_builtin_saveregs): Reworked to use homed arglists, as recommended in the calling standard. (alpha_need_gp): Deleted, code moved into output_prolog. (alpha_gp_dead_after): Deleted; optimization is not safe. (alpha_write_verstamp): New function. (output_prolog, output_epilog): Major rework to update to current calling standard. From-SVN: r3459
Richard Kenner committed -
Use current_file_function_operand to see when we can use BSR. From-SVN: r3458
Richard Kenner committed -
(SLOW_UNALIGNED_ACCESS): Define as 1. (ARG_POINTER_REGNUM): Use register number 31 as an arg pointer. (FRAME_GROWS_DOWNWARD): Do not define. (STARTING_FRAME_OFFSET): Now is outgoing args size. (FIRST_PARM_OFFSET): Now 0. (ELIMINABLE_REGS, etc.): Cannot eliminate gp, but do eliminate AP in favor of either SP or FP. (RETURN_IN_MEMORY): All structs or integers larger than 64 bits get returned via memory. (SETUP_INCOMING_VARARGS): Use homed arglist mechanism. (ASM_DECLARE_FUNCTION_NAME): Use proper second arg to .ent. (ASM_FILE_START): Call alpha_write_verstamp. (ENCODE_SECTION_INFO): Record when a decl is for a function in the current file. From-SVN: r3457
Richard Kenner committed -
use sysv3. From-SVN: r3456
John Hassey committed -
in type of 1st arg of builtin function. From-SVN: r3455
Richard Stallman committed -
* alpha.md (fix_truncdfdi2, fix_truncsfdi2): Use `cvttqc', not `cvttq', to avoid rounding up. From-SVN: r3454
Brendan Kehoe committed
-
- 09 Feb, 1993 11 commits
-
-
From-SVN: r3453
Richard Stallman committed -
From-SVN: r3452
Richard Stallman committed -
(combine_instructions): Add calls to setup_incoming_promotions. From-SVN: r3451
Richard Kenner committed -
From-SVN: r3450
Richard Kenner committed -
From-SVN: r3449
Richard Kenner committed -
* fixincludes: Fix logic about when to duplicate entries under the `FILE' link. From-SVN: r3448
Brendan Kehoe committed -
(finclude): Likewise. From-SVN: r3447
Richard Stallman committed -
From-SVN: r3446
Michael Meissner committed -
From-SVN: r3445
Richard Kenner committed -
set things up so that we can call get_last value; call record_dead_and_set_regs in loop. (set_nonzero_bits_and_sign_copies): Handle paradoxical SET. From-SVN: r3444
Richard Kenner committed -
From-SVN: r3443
Richard Stallman committed
-
- 08 Feb, 1993 6 commits
-
-
From-SVN: r3442
John Hassey committed -
From-SVN: r3441
James Van Artsdalen committed -
(struct arg_data): New fields aligned_regs and n_aligned_regs. (expand_call): Set and use these fields when required. (store_one_arg): Don't pass reg to emit_push_insn if we have previously formed aligned registers. From-SVN: r3440
Richard Kenner committed -
From-SVN: r3439
Richard Kenner committed -
(MUST_PASS_IN_STACK): No problem anymore with nonaligned structs. From-SVN: r3438
Richard Kenner committed -
From-SVN: r3437
Richard Stallman committed
-
- 07 Feb, 1993 2 commits
-
-
(expand_call, store_one_arg): Use it to ensure that all args get promoted if requested, not just those passed in registers. From-SVN: r3436
Richard Kenner committed -
imagine some close-braces to pop them. From-SVN: r3435
Richard Stallman committed
-